For a warehouse with rectangular footprint, East {West length 100m, North /South length 60111, and aisles that run North] South, suppose the loading dock is in the oenter of the southern east/west wall. As usual, approximate the uniform discrete distribution of aisle locations with a continuous uniform distribution. (3) Find the expected distance traveled to retrieve one randomly.r located item and return to the loading dock. (b) Find the expected distance traveled to retrieve two randomly located items and return to the loading dock. Simplify your model by assum- ing that the two items are not in the same aisle. (c) Suppose 20% of the item types account for 90% of the items retrieved. 'I'heee fast-moving items are stored in the aisles between 40m and 60m from the west well (the centermoat aisles). Find the expected distance traveled to retrieve two items and return to the loading dock. Assume the two items are in different aisles
